Funeral services for Mrs. Jean Dumas Barmore, age 83 of Dubach, LA will be held at 2:00 PM, Thursday, November 20, 2025 at Mineral Springs Baptist Church with Rev. Greg Tipton and Rev. Barry Joyner officiating. Burial will follow in Mineral Springs Cemetery in Dubach under the direction of Owens Memorial Chapel Funeral Home of Ruston, LA.
Jean was born January 5, 1942 in Plaquemine, LA to Zettie Neel Dumas and James Odis Dumas and passed away peacefully Monday, November 17, 2025 in West Monroe, LA surrounded by her loved ones. She built a full and joyful life rooted in family, faith, and service to others.
Over the years, Jean worked in a variety of roles and touched countless lives through her dedication and strong work ethic. She spent many years as an inspector at Laurens Glass and later served as Personnel Director at Long Leaf Nursing Home, among other positions throughout her lifetime.
Jean was happiest when surrounded by family. She loved fishing, hunting, cooking, and spending as much time with Ted as she could. She also delighted in playing the organ at church, sewing, and offering a helping hand to anyone in need. Her bold personality, warm smile, and generous heart made her unforgettable. Jean never met a stranger—if she did, they were friends by the time the conversation ended.
Jean is survived by her devoted husband, Ted Barmore; her children Judy Baker (Steve), Julie Brown (Jason), Bubba Lee (Patricia), Lori Knox (Raymond), and Brandon Barmore (Stephanie); Brother, Bud Dumas (Betty); and her many grandchildren and great-grandchildren, each of whom held a special place in her heart. Her grandchildren include Chris Baker (Emily), Dusty Baker, Megan Boyce (Mims), Jodi Perritt (Greg), Kasey Baker (Hannah), Annie Cain (Jacob), Justin Wininger (Heather), Jayme Bell (Jamie), Kaylee Brown, Cassidy Barmore, Abagael Barmore, Connor Lee, Brenden Barmore, Jordan Durant, Seth McGraw, and Allison McGraw, along with numerous great-grandchildren who brought her endless joy.
Serving as pallbearers will be Chris Baker, Dusty Baker, Kasey Baker, Brendan Barmore, Will Billberry, and Michael Barmore. Honorary pallbearer is Jordan Durant.
The family extends a heartfelt thank-you to Morgan Barmore for her commitment to always being there for Jean along with Glenwood Regional Medical Center and Alpine Skilled Nursing and Rehabilitation for the exceptional care and compassion they provided during Jean's final days
Jean leaves behind a legacy of strength, love, and kindness that will continue to live on in all who knew her. She will be profoundly missed
